International owners are usually looking for answers to a specific truck problem that is starting to hurt operations. These are some of the issues that most often create downtime and force a decision.
Fault codes, performance concerns, and warning lights require real diagnosis before time and money get wasted on the wrong repair path.
Radiator, hose, coolant, and overheating concerns can quickly lead to more serious engine damage if they are left alone.
Charging issues, wiring concerns, intermittent faults, and hard-to-track electrical problems need a disciplined diagnostic process.
Brake issues, leaks, and other DOT-related concerns can become much more expensive once they affect inspections, safety, or operating time.
Oil leaks, coolant leaks, vibration, hesitation, and other drivability complaints often signal a larger problem building underneath.
